1969 - Denver, CO, received 9.6 inches of snow. October of that year proved to be the coldest and snowiest of record for Denver, with a total snowfall for the month of 31.2 inches.

Lindrith is an unincorporated community in Rio Arriba County, New Mexico, United States. Lindrith is located in southern Rio Arriba County along New Mexico State Road 595. Lindrith has a post office with ZIP code 87029. The Lindrith Airpark, a public-use airport, is located in Lindrith. Lindrith has a charter elementary school, the Lindrith Area Heritage School.
